Study: Let’s Revisit Extended Antibiotic Prophylaxis in Joint Replacement
SAN FRANCISCO — Routinely giving antibiotic prophylaxis for 10 days in arthroplasty patients apparently did nothing beyond what was achieved with shorter protocols to prevent prosthetic joint infections (PJIs) at one major medical center. PJI rates at Vanderbilt University Medical Center in Nashville were no lower after a policy was implemented in 2020 to provide […]
Coffee with milk may have an anti-inflammatory effect
Can something as simple as a cup of coffee with milk have an anti-inflammatory effect in humans? Apparently so, according to a new study from the University of Copenhagen. A combination of proteins and antioxidants doubles the anti-inflammatory properties in immune cells. The researchers hope to be able to study the health effects on humans. […]
